From personal experience in the job and also community and endgame.
- Dancer as a main role was a great solo class with its abilities.
- Party support in small groups (2-4) worked very well in things like XP parties and normal grind content.
It's weakness in XI was Endgame. As a subjob it provided more in endgame than the main job did. It's DPS/Support were just too little for the content compared to other jobs. You need to take into consideration the main content after DNC was released was Abyssea beyond WotG.
Only if it had a defined role across content like other jobs in XIV bring. Otherwise it will just be something to lvl for cross-class abilities. Which if they did bring it to XIV, then it should be a class, rather than a job.
